Bevier Baseball at Brashear April 29, 2010

The host Tigers sweep a varsity/JV double-header.

A leadoff walk by Pipes and a Yount home run staked Bevier to a 1st inning lead, but it wouldn't stand up as Brashear answered with 7 runs in the bottom of the 1st and 2 more in the 2nd. Bevier scored again in the 3rd on a 3-run Shelmadine homer, but Brashear answered with 3 in the bottom of the 3rd including a Hayden Housman home run and 4 in the 4th including a Matt Thomas home run. Bevier's last scoring came in the 5th as they scored 3 more, but Brashear put up 2 more in the 6th to claim a 17-8 win. For Brashear, Hayden Coin, Matt Thomas, Cody Snelling, and Jay Scudder had 2 hits each, with Hayden Housman, Adam Songer, and Nick Thomas also having hits. For Bevier, Pipes had 3 hits, Shelmadine and Yount had 2 hits each, and Basler had a hit. Cody Snelling got the win for Brashear striking out 9, with Matt Thomas pitching an inning of relief with 2 strikeouts. McGhee took the loss for Bevier with Yount and Shelmadine pitching in relief. Brashear took the JV game by a score of 3-2.
